Collection of Antique Kabbalistic Seforim, 1821–1860 - 1. Mikdash Melech, a commentary on the holy Zohar on Vayikra–Devarim, by the divine kabbalist Rabbi Shalom Buzaglo. Sudilkov, 1821. Ownership inscriptions of R. Rafael Hammer, moreh tzedek in Sauverin? (later the first Av Beit Din of Kompálong). Signatures: Menachem Hecht, village of Slaviza; Moshe Hecht, Zlabiza. Vol. 3: Vayikra. [1], 104 leaves. Vols. 4–5: Bamidbar–Devarim. [1], 114, [1] leaves. 21 cm. Overall Great Condition, few light stains, sumptuous new red leather binding with owners name. 2 . Sefer Kisei Melech, a commentary on Tikkunei ha-Zohar, the foundational work on the Tikkunim by the kabbalist Rabbi Shalom Buzaglo. Second edition. Lemberg (Lviv), 1860. Stamps: Aharon Mattityah Spielman, Munkács. Signature: Meshulam Zusha … [4], 7–132 leaves. 19.3 cm. Overall Good Condition, some stains, page [2] has tear slightly affecting text, few small marginal tears, old half leather binding slightly damaged. 3 . Zohar, Fourth Part,   Livorno imprint. With signatures and marginal notes by a Yemenite sage. 257 Leaves. 24.5 cm. Overall Very Good Condition, some frayed edges, some stains, half of title page missing, sumptuous new red leather binding with owners name.
